body {
  font-family: Trebuchet MS, Verdana, Arial CE;
  font-size: 12px;
  color: #000;
  background: #fff;
}

a {
  text-decoration: none;
}


a:hover {
  text-decoration: underline;
}

hr {border: 0px; height: 1px; border-top: 1px #222 solid; margin-bottom: 10px;}

#main {
  background: url(/images/bgt2print.jpg) bottom no-repeat;
  width: 540px;
  margin: auto auto;
}

#top {
  background: url(/images/bgt1print.gif) no-repeat;
  height: 98px;
}

#hdr {
display: none;
}

#tfl {padding: 5px; float: left; width: 115px;}
#tfr {padding: 10px; float: right; padding-top: 110px;; width: 216px;}
#tfr a, #tfr img {vertical-align: middle}

#colL {
  width: 500px;
  padding: 10px;
}

#colR {
  display:none;
}

.wpis {
  clear: both; 
  border-bottom: 1px #666 solid;
  padding-bottom: 0px;
  margin-bottom: 5px;
  color: #000;
  line-height: 18px;
}

.wpiscom { display: none;}

.calENDar {background: none; float: left; margin-right: 10px; width: 50px; height: 55px; border: 1px #777 solid; text-align: center; color: #555; font-weight: bold; line-height: 18px;}
.calENDar em {font-style: normal; font-size: 16px; line-height: 18px; color: #000}

.wpis img { border: 2px #555 solid; float: right; margin-left: 10px;}

h1, h1 a  {font-size: 24px; color: #555; line-height: 28px; text-decoration; none;}
h3, h3 a  { color: #555; font-size: 17px; font-weight: normal; margin-bottom: 5px;}
h2 {color: #555; font-size: 32px; margin-top: 0px;}


#menu {margin-bottom: 15px; padding-bottom: 15px; border-bottom: 1px #555 solid;  }
#menu a {color: #000; background: url(/images/mbx.gif) 0px 5px no-repeat; display: block; padding-left: 14px; margin-left: 10px; }
#menu a:hover {color: #000; text-decoration: underline;}

#sonda {margin-bottom: 15px; padding-bottom: 15px; border-bottom: 1px #555 solid; }
#sonda b {font-size: 12px; color: #555}
#sonda p {margin-bottom: 10px; margin-top: 0px; padding-left: 5px; color: #666;}
#szukajmini {margin-bottom: 15px; padding-bottom: 15px; border-bottom: 1px #555 solid;  }
#szukajmaxi {margin-bottom: 15px; padding-bottom: 15px; color: #555;}

#redakcja {margin-bottom: 15px; padding-bottom: 15px; border-bottom: 1px #1d1b1b solid;font-size: 10px; color: #666  }
#redakcja a { color: #666; text-decoration: none;}
#redakcja a:hover { color: #000; text-decoration: underline;}

#footer { padding: 20px; padding-bottom: 5px; font-size: 10px; color: #888;}
#footer a { color: #000; text-decoration: none;}
#footer a:hover { color: #666; text-decoration: underline;}

.submit {border: 1px #666 solid; background: #fff; color: #444; font-weight: bold; font-size: 11px; padding: 3px;}
.submit2 {text-align: center; width: 110px; display: block; border: 1px #666 solid; background: #fff; color: #444; font-weight: bold; font-size: 11px; padding: 3px;}
.input {border: 1px #666 solid; background:#fff; font-size: 12px; color:#444; padding: 4px; }
.c0 {color: #000}
.c1,.d1 {color: #666}
.c2 {color: #888}

#phregion { width: 164px; padding: 5px; border: 1px #222 solid; float: right; margin-left: 10px; }
#phregion p { margin: 2px; text-align: center;}
#phregion a { font-size: 10px; color: #666;}
#phregion a:hover { color: #666; text-decoration: underline;}

.score b { font-size: 14px;}
.score {font-size: 10px; color: #666;}
.score em {font-size: 16px; font-weight: normal; font-style: normal; color: #666;}

.phzoom { display: block; border: 2px #222 solid; margin-bottom: 2px;} 
.phzoom:hover { border: 2px #666 solid; } 

#gallery img {border: 0px;}
.galpix { width: 130px; display: block; border: 2px #222 solid; margin: 15px; float: left;} 
.galpix:hover { border: 2px #666 solid; } 

.mvplayer {
  width: 320px;
  height: 270px;
  margin: 20px auto;
  padding: 4px;
  background: #000;
  position: relative;
}
.polla {padding: 1px; background: #fff;}
.pollb {background: #ddd;}
.pollc {margin-left: 5px; margin-top: -18px; color: #000; font-size: 10px}
.mvplayer p {margin: 0px;}

.subPages { clear: both; margin-top: 15px; font-size: 11px; width: 100%; border: 1px #333 solid; }
.subPages td { padding: 4px; background: #fff; font-size: 11px; color: #555 }
.subPages a { color: #555 }
.subPages a:hover { color: #555 }

.comments {font-size: 11px; color: #000; width: 500px;}

.cauth {float: left; margin-right: 10px; margin-bottom: 20px;}
.thread {color: #000; clear: both; border: 1px #1 solid; background: #eee;  no-repeat; padding: 10px; padding-top: 15px; padding-bottom: 0px; margin-top: -5px;}
.commnt {color: #000; clear: both; border: 1px #1 solid; background: #eee;  padding: 10px; padding-top: 15px; padding-bottom: 0px; margin-top: -5px;}
.cmarg {clear: both; margin-bottom: 10px;}
.comma {text-align: right; font-size: 10px;}
.comma a {color: #000; font-weight: bold;}
.printNone {display: none;}

